LG Q Stylus vs LG W10
Here you can compare LG Q Stylus and LG W10. Comparing LG Q Stylus vs LG W10 on Smartprix enables you to check their respective specs scores and unique features. It would potentially help you understand how LG Q Stylus stands against LG W10 and which one should you buy The current lowest price found for LG Q Stylus is ₹15,899 and for LG W10 is ₹5,999. The details of both of these products were last updated on Mar 22, 2024.
Specification | LG Q Stylus | LG W10 |
---|---|---|
Battery | 3300 mAh, Li-ion Battery | 4000 mAh, Li-ion Battery |
OS | Android v8.1 (Oreo) | Android v9.0 (Pie) |
CPU | 1.8 GHz, Octa Core Processor | 2 GHz, Octa Core Processor |
Rear Camera | 16 MP with autofocus | 13 MP + 5 MP with autofocus |
RAM | 3 GB | 3 GB |
Price | ₹15,899 | ₹5,999 |

General
Sim Type | Dual Sim, GSM+GSM | Dual Sim, GSM+GSM |
Dual Sim | Yes | Yes |
Sim Size | Nano+Nano SIM | Nano+Nano SIM |
Device Type | Smartphone | Smartphone |
Release Date | June, 2018 | June, 2019 |
Design
Dimensions | 160.15 x 77.75 x 8.1 mm | 76.2 x 156 x 8.5 mm |
Weight | 171 g | 164 g |
Display
Type | Color IPS LCD Screen (16M Colors) | Color IPS LCD Screen (16M Colors) |
Touch | Yes | Yes |
Size | 6.2 inches, 2160 x 1080 pixels | 6.19 inches, 720 x 1500 pixels |
Aspect Ratio | 18:9 | 19:9 |
PPI | ~ 390 PPI | ~ 277 PPI |
Screen to Body Ratio | ~ 82.1% | |
Notch | Yes, Small Notch |
Memory
RAM | 3 GB | 3 GB |
Storage | 32 GB | 32 GB |
Card Slot | Yes, upto 512 GB | Yes, upto 256 GB |
Connectivity
GPRS | Yes | Yes |
EDGE | Yes | Yes |
3G | Yes | Yes |
4G | Yes | Yes |
VoLTE | Yes | Yes |
Wifi | Yes, with wifi-hotspot | Yes, with wifi-hotspot |
Bluetooth | Yes, v4.2 | Yes, v4.2, A2DP, LE |
USB | Yes, Type-C v2.0 | Yes, microUSB v2.0 |
USB Features | USB Charging, USB Storage |
Extra
GPS | Yes | yes with A-GPS |
Fingerprint Sensor | Yes | Yes, Rear |
Face Unlock | Yes | |
Sensors | Accelerometer, Gyro, Proximity, Compass | Light sensor, Proximity sensor, Accelerometer |
3.5mm Headphone Jack | Yes | Yes |
NFC | Yes | |
Extra Features | Stylus included |
Camera
Rear Camera | 16 MP with autofocus | 13 MP + 5 MP with autofocus |
Features | Digital Zoom, Auto Flash, Face detection, Touch to focus | |
Video Recording | 1080p @ 30 fps FHD | 1080p @ 30 fps FHD |
Flash | Yes, LED | Yes, LED |
Front Camera | 8 MP | 8 MP |
Technical
OS | Android v8.1 (Oreo) | Android v9.0 (Pie) |
Chipset | Mediatek Helio MT6750 | MediaTek Helio P22 |
CPU | 1.8 GHz, Octa Core Processor | 2 GHz, Octa Core Processor |
Core Details | 4x2.4 GHz Cortex-A53 & 4x1.6 GHz Cortex-A53 | |
GPU | Mali-T860MP2 | IMG PowerVR GE8320 |
Java | Yes, via 3rd party | No |
Browser | Yes, supports HTML5 | Yes, supports HTML5 |
Multimedia
Yes | Yes | |
Music | Yes | Yes |
Video | Yes | Yes |
FM Radio | Yes | No |
Document Reader | Yes | Yes |
Battery
Type | Non-Removable Battery | Non-Removable Battery |
Size | 3300 mAh, Li-ion Battery | 4000 mAh, Li-ion Battery |
